What is Fat Back?
Fat back refers to excess adipose tissue located between the shoulder blades and along the upper and mid-back. Unlike localized fat in other areas, fat back may accumulate due to a combination of genetics, hormonal imbalances, poor posture, or uneven muscle development. It’s often noticed as a visible bulge, GH-stretching of clothing, or difficulty feeling the natural spine curves.

Why Does Fat Back Develop?
Several factors contribute to the formation of fat back:
1. Poor Posture
Slouching or prolonged sitting weakens the mid-back muscles and promotes fat deposition in the area due to reduced blood flow and metabolic activity.
2. Genetics
Your genetic makeup influences where fat is stored in the body. Some people naturally carry more fat in the upper back.
3. Sedentary Lifestyle
Lack of activity slows metabolism and allows fat to accumulate, particularly if muscle mass is low.

4. Hormonal Imbalances
Conditions like hypothyroidism or insulin resistance can disrupt normal fat distribution, potentially leading to increased fat in the back area.
5. Muscle Imbalance
Weak upper back muscles compared to chest and shoulder muscles may favor fat pad formation due to structural imbalance.
Health Implications of Fat Back
Though often considered purely aesthetic, fat back isn’t just a cosmetic concern. Excess fat in this region can:
- Reduce spinal mobility and cause discomfort
- Contribute to poor posture and chronic neck/back pain
- Increase the risk of obesity-related diseases such as type 2 diabetes and cardiovascular issues
- Affect self-esteem and mental well-being
